Saladin and Richard the Lionheart: The Rivalry That Shaped the Third Crusade

from Saladin: The Muslim Leader Who Defeated Crusaders — Fexingo History · host Fexingo

In this episode, Lucas and Luna explore the complex dynamic between Saladin and Richard the Lionheart during the Third Crusade. They delve into the famous encounter at Arsuf in 1191, where Saladin's tactical brilliance was matched by Richard's discipline. The discussion covers the negotiations for a truce, the controversial execution of prisoners at Acre, and the legend of chivalric admiration that grew between the two leaders. Drawing on accounts from Baha ad-Din ibn Shaddad and Imad ad-Din al-Isfahani, the hosts examine how this rivalry shaped the political landscape of the Levant.
